100 Examples of sentences containing the common noun "ignition"
Definition
"Ignition" refers to the process of initiating combustion in an engine or the act of starting a fire. It can also denote the mechanism or system that facilitates this process. In broader contexts, it can symbolize the beginning of an event or process.
